リソース: Mesh
Mesh は、サービス メッシュ内のワークロード間の通信の論理構成グループを表します。メッシュを指すルートは、この論理メッシュ境界内でのリクエストのルーティング方法を指定します。
JSON 表現 |
---|
{
"name": string,
"selfLink": string,
"createTime": string,
"updateTime": string,
"labels": {
string: string,
...
},
"description": string,
"interceptionPort": integer,
"envoyHeaders": enum ( |
フィールド | |
---|---|
name |
必須。Mesh リソースの名前。パターン |
selfLink |
出力専用。このリソースのサーバー定義 URL |
createTime |
出力専用。リソース作成時のタイムスタンプ。 RFC3339 UTC「Zulu」形式のタイムスタンプ。精度はナノ秒まで、小数点以下は最大 9 桁。例: |
updateTime |
出力専用。リソース更新時のタイムスタンプ。 RFC3339 UTC「Zulu」形式のタイムスタンプ。精度はナノ秒まで、小数点以下は最大 9 桁。例: |
labels |
省略可。Mesh リソースに関連付けられたラベルタグのセット。
|
description |
省略可。リソースのフリーテキストの説明。最大長は 1,024 文字です。 |
interceptionPort |
省略可。有効な TCP ポート(1~65535)が設定されている場合は、SIDECAR プロキシに localhost(127.0.0.1)アドレスの指定されたポートでリッスンするよう指示します。SIDECAR プロキシは、実際の ip:port の宛先に関係なく、すべてのトラフィックがこのポートにリダイレクトされることを想定しています。設定されていない場合、ポート「15001」がインターセプト ポートとして使用されます。これは、サイドカー プロキシのデプロイにのみ適用されます。 |
envoyHeaders |
省略可。envoy が内部デバッグ ヘッダーをアップストリーム リクエストに挿入するかどうかを指定します。他の Envoy ヘッダーが挿入される可能性もあります。デフォルトでは、Envoy はデバッグ ヘッダーを挿入しません。 |
メソッド |
|
---|---|
|
指定されたプロジェクトとロケーションで新しい Mesh を作成します。 |
|
1 つの Mesh を削除します。 |
|
1 つの Mesh の詳細を取得します。 |
|
指定されたプロジェクトとロケーションでのメッシュを一覧で表示します。 |
|
単一の Mesh のパラメータを更新します。 |
|
指定したリソースにアクセス制御ポリシーを設定します。 |
|
呼び出し元が指定されたリソース上で持つ権限を返します。 |